It made me cringe sooooooooooo much. I have to confess to having a subterranean dislike for deals when they cause people to move in with hands like K-Q and Q-8, but, at the same time, we have to remember that the Broadway and Vienna main events endured in excess of 7 hours of heads-up play.. even though big deals had been made.

I think sometimes it just depends on the players involved.

Just thought i should say myself and Paul have no problem with eachother. However i know sometimes thats how it appears. We are both part of the MMM group of poker friends, and are just that friends. Its because we are friends that we can discuss our view so heavily.

I think all of us have come to poker from many diffrent avenues and so to all of us the deal represents something diffrent. For me the extra cash to allow me to 'freeroll' for a year is very important as i have no outside income.

However if we take someone, say Rob Yong (hope he doesnt mind, lol) who has financial intrests outside of poker to rely on then a deal may well be wrong for him.
